The contract solicitation seeks qualified contractors to conduct terrestrial assessment, inventory, and monitoring surveys across Oregon and Washington, focusing on ecological data collection and analysis to support land and resource management decisions by the Department of the Interior. The work will involve field-based surveys to document terrestrial species, habitats, and environmental conditions, with deliverables intended to inform conservation planning, compliance, and scientific research. The solicitation is issued under NAICS code 541620 for environmental consulting services and is managed by the Oregon State Office located in Portland, Oregon. Proposals must be submitted by August 22, 2026, with inquiries directed to Matthew Duane, the primary point of contact at the provided email and phone number. Performance is anticipated to occur throughout the designated regions of Oregon and Washington without a specified single location.
